project Euler problem 9

/**
 * Created by Administrator on 2015/5/9.
 */
public class E9 {
    public static int[] computeTri()
    {
        int []temp=new int[3];
        for(int i=1;i<1000;i++)
        {
            for(int j=i;j<1000;j++)
                if(i*i+j*j==(1000-i-j)*(1000-i-j))
                {
                    temp[0]=i;
                    temp[1]=j;
                    temp[2]=1000-i-j;
                }

        }
        return  temp;
    }

    public static void main(String[] args) {
        long sum=computeTri()[0]*computeTri()[1]*computeTri()[2];
        System.out.println(sum);
    }
}
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章